The Winter Solstice: Understanding Its Timing and Significance

The Winter Solstice, often celebrated and recognized in various cultures across the globe, marks a pivotal moment in Earth’s annual cycle. This astronomical event, which occurs around December 21st or 22nd in the Northern Hemisphere, signals the longest night and the shortest day of the year. As the Earth orbits the sun, the tilt of our planet results in a profound shift in light and darkness, giving rise to not only distinct seasonal changes but also rich cultural traditions and practices that have evolved over millennia. The Winter Solstice: A Critical Moment in Earth’s Cycle

The Winter Solstice is an extraordinary event that showcases the complexity of Earth’s relationship with the sun. During this time, the Northern Hemisphere is tilted farthest away from the sun, resulting in minimal sunlight and, consequently, cooler temperatures. This astronomical alignment creates a stark contrast between the solstice and other times of the year, marking the transition from autumn to winter. The implications of this seasonal shift are profound, affecting everything from weather patterns to agricultural cycles, thus influencing human activities and survival strategies.

As the solstice approaches, daylight hours gradually diminish, creating an atmosphere of introspection and reflection. The return of longer days after the solstice represents a powerful turning point, symbolizing rebirth and renewal. For many ancient cultures, this change was significant; they recognized the solstice as a time to honor the sun and its critical role in sustaining life. Unraveling the Cultural and Scientific Importance of Solstice

The cultural significance of the Winter Solstice is as rich and varied as the traditions that celebrate it. Across different civilizations and religions, the solstice has been marked by festivities and rituals that emphasize themes of renewal, light, and hope. From ancient Roman Saturnalia to modern-day Yule celebrations, the arrival of the solstice has historically been seen as a time to gather with loved ones, reflect on the past year, and look forward to the future.
